Add 1/49 and 56/24

1st number: 1/49, 2nd number: 2 8/24

1/49 + 56/24 is 346/147.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 49 and 24 is 1176

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 1176
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 49 × 24 = 1176,
    1/49 = 1 × 24/49 × 24 = 24/1176
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 24 × 49 = 1176,
    56/24 = 56 × 49/24 × 49 = 2744/1176
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    24/1176 + 2744/1176 = 24 + 2744/1176 = 2768/1176
  5. 2768/1176 simplified gives 346/147
  6. So, 1/49 + 56/24 = 346/147
